Pantone® PLUS SOLID COLOR SET Coated & Uncoated The Solid Color Set combines all 2,161 Pantone Spot shades into practical formats designed for every step of the graphic and printing process. The compact Formula Guide provides creators with a mobile tool for color selection and inspiration, whereas the Solid Chips Books serve as a desktop resource featuring detachable chips perfect for creating palettes, collaborating with teams, and securing approvals.
Features the Pantone Formula Guide alongside the Solid Chips Books. Merges a mobile, individual color guide with a desktop reference tool. Packaged with Paper Chip Savers for neat organization and storage of loose color samples.
Detachable chips provide shareable, flexible color options for inspiration, communication, and quality Assurance.
Format: Contains the Formula Guide (two compact, handheld fan decks) and Solid Chips Books (two three-ring binders). Includes two Paper Chip Savers to easily organize and store loose samples. The Chips Books contain all existing Pantone Spot shades as perforated, tear-out paper samples with three-sided color bleed, perfect for accurate color assessment. Each page displays up to seven Pantone shades, with six separate 1.2” x 0.8” chips per color. Every shade is printed on standard industry paper weights (100 lb coated and 80 lb uncoated). A Lighting Indicator page within the Formula Guide highlights whether current lighting is optimal for assessing color accurately.
Color: Updated with 294 fresh, trend-driven graphics shades, bringing the total to 2,161 spot colors. Every shade is presented with its specific title or digit; the Formula Guide also provides ink mixing formulas. Colors are organized chromatically, with the newest shade pages highlighted at the upper corners and blended throughout the guides. Indexes located at the rear of the guides and the front of the books offer a numerical guide to find each color. The targeted tolerance is <2dE relative to our master standard data.
